javascript - Froala Editor - 插入多张图片

标签 javascript angularjs froala

我正在使用 Froala Editor,在尝试插入多张图片时偶然发现了一个问题。问题是只插入了第一张图像,而没有插入其余图像。我在网上搜索了答案,但找不到任何答案。是否可以一次插入多张图片?

这是我的代码:

function show() {
    $current_image = editor.image.get();

    var image = {
        id: 0
    }

    angular
        .element($('html'))
        .scope()
        .showImageManager(image)
        .then(function (imageList) {                    
            for (var i = 0; i < imageList.length; i++) {              
                    insert(imageList[i].url);                         
            }
        });
}

function insert(url) {
    if (!$current_image) {
        // Make sure we have focus.
        editor.events.focus(true);
        editor.selection.restore();
    }
    else {
        $current_image.trigger('click');
    }

    editor.undo.saveStep();
    editor.image.insert(url, false, {}, $current_image, { });
}

最佳答案

我已经手动解决了多张图片上传问题。

请找到附加的 image.min.js 并将其替换为 floara 编辑器 image.min.js。

它对我来说很好用。如果您有任何问题,请告诉我,请根据您的要求进行更新。 请将 image.min.txt 更改为 image.min.js。

image.min.txt

谢谢。
桑杰·帕尔马

关于javascript - Froala Editor - 插入多张图片,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/42782861/

相关文章:

javascript - 如何在 javascript 中显示带有 .html 的链接

javascript - 正常重定向或预加载

AngularJS使用$http服务进行跨域请求

javascript - 将文本添加到 Froala 文本编辑器

javascript - 验证表单后选项卡崩溃(JavaScript)

javascript - 当 redux 状态改变时,功能组件不会重新渲染

angularjs - Angular : Error: Unknown provider during module. 配置()

angularjs - 在 Jasmine 单元测试中设置 ReactiveForm 的值

jquery - 如何在 froala 编辑器上重置(UNDO 和 REDO)按钮的状态

javascript - 无法从 froala 编辑器上传图像